      Kesha (formerly stylized Ke$ha), full name - Kesha Rose Sebert, is an American singer & songwriter.

      In 2005, at age 18, Kesha was signed to Kemosabe Records. Her first major success came in early 2009 after she was featured on American rapper Flo Rida's number-one single "Right Round".

       

      As of 2019, Kesha has sold over 71 million records in the US and over 134 million records worldwide. Kesha was also listed as the 26th top artist on Billboard's decade end charts from 2010 to 2019.

      Luke Combs Background

      Luke Albert Combs in one of the few people in the music industry who goes by his actual name. He was born and raised in Asheville, North Carolina, and showed interest in singing and music from a young age. During high school, he was both athletic and musically gifted, as he participated in high school football and multiple vocalist groups. He even did a solo performance in Carnegie Hall.

      When he went to college, Combs still kept his mind on music. He performed at his first country music show and eventually dropped out of college to further pursue his music career. With his background in music, he moved to Nashville and released his first EP in 2014 called, The Way She Rides, which was an instant success.  

       

      Luke Combs’ Greatest Hits

      Almost everything that Luke Combs released was thoroughly enjoyed by his fans and received recognition. Some of his most popular songs include “Hurricane,” “She Got the Best of Me,” as well as “Beautiful Crazy,” and “One Number Away.” In 2018, Luke Combs won the New Country Artist of the Year Award from iHeart Radio Music Awards, further solidifying his presence in the country music realm.
